About the Indiana Office of Energy Development :

The Indiana Office of Energy Development (OED) was established to shepherd the state's energy plan. OED focuses on the development and implementation of comprehensive energy planning for the state that utilizes all of Indiana's energy resources and supports a strong, dynamic, and growing economy. OED strives to be a national leader in the creation of innovative policy solutions and programs for affordable, reliable energy.

Role Overview

The Accountant will work under the Finance Director in managing the daily administration of funding inflows and outflows for the assigned grant programs. This will include processing accounts payable and receivable, vouchers, deposits, reimbursement requests, federal revenue draws, and other financial processes. The Accountant will be expected to serve as the point of contact for all financial matters surrounding their assigned grant program. The incumbent will provide support to the Finance Director in budget analysis and fiscal oversight for each assigned grant program and support the Finance Director in ensuring that all grant programs are properly accounting for all funded activities.

    A Day in the Life :

    The essential functions of this role are as follows :

  • Prepare, examine, and analyze accounting records financial reports to assess compliance with procedural standards.
  • Analyze business operations, trends, costs, revenues, financial commitments, and obligations to project future revenues and expenses or to provide advice.
  • Assist the supervisor in analyzing budgets, preparing periodic reports that compare budgeted costs to actual costs.
  • Advise the controller or supervisor on the status of assigned accounts.
  • Assist in the development of general policies for a fiscal program.
  • Assist management in the preparation of agency or program area budget requests.
  • Reconcile complex discrepancies between accounts and notifies the appropriate department or supervisor of errors.
  • Prepare reports for reconciliation of grant funded accounts.
  • Analyze and interpret financial statements and reports for accuracy.
  • Serve as liaison between agency and the federal government or other funding source for assigned account.
  • Coordinate computerized accounting system within assigned area.
  • Control the flow of appropriated funds.
  • Direct the work of lower-level accountants and account clerks assisting in complex or unusual situations.
